It was actually my first "real deal" flashlight, also recommended by this community.

I went for xhp70.3 HI 5700K r9050, also recommended here. I didn't understand terminology much, but most people said that this CCT has the least green tint.

I liked it, and it made me buy more flashlights and made more curious.

Recently I swapped in 4000K r70 for more warmth and output, and I like it even more (but colors do look meh now)

Also recently I swapped in SFT-25R into Anduril S21E (it had 519a), and damn it's a beast. It went from a good flashlight to a unique beast. It throws like crazy, is brighter in hotspot than M21H and DA1K, and gets good warm (I'm feeling power now 😁).

So in short, M21H is great, it provided great first experience and ignited curiosity in me. Now I'm just swapping around TIRs based on my mood, thinking of adding a clip just in case. Also I added 35mm GITD seal ring to it, looks nice.

I saw that you just started soldering, so I guess this may be a new project for you.

I just ordered a new LED on a 20mm MPCB from Convoy, unscrewed bezel, removed optic and TIR, then unsoldered old MPCB and soldered a new one in.

The thing glowing green in the pic is a silicone glow in the dark O-ring between glass and bezel.
